Role: Code Compliance Engineer (Remote)

Location: Remote (Work from Anywhere)
Job Type: Contract
Payout: $50 - $80/hour

Role Overview:

We are hiring for one of our clients, seeking a Building Code Compliance Expert to work on a contract basis. The role involves analyzing and interpreting building codes to ensure projects meet regulatory standards. Responsibilities include reviewing architectural and engineering plans, conducting site inspections, and providing compliance recommendations.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Review architectural and engineering plans for compliance with local, state, and federal building codes.
  • Conduct thorough site inspections to verify adherence to approved plans and applicable regulations.
  • Identify code violations and propose corrective actions to maintain compliance.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ams including architects, engineers, and contractors to resolve compliance issues.
  • Prepare detailed reports documenting code compliance findings and recommendations.

Required Skills & Qualifications:

  • Proficiency in interpreting and applying building codes, zoning laws, and safety regulations.
  • Experience conducting site inspections and audits for construction projects.
  • Strong analytical skills with attention to detail in reviewing technical documentation.
  • Ability to communicate compliance requirements clearly to non-technical stakeholders.
  • Knowledge of construction practices and standards in commercial and residential sectors.
